What therapy approaches do you use?

I work in an integrated way, drawing on a variety of evidence-based approaches to meet the needs of the person I am working with. I primarily draws on Eye Movement Desensitisation and  Reprocessing (EMDR) therapy and Schema Therapy (ST), whilst also integrating skills from other relevant approaches, including  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T),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), and Dialectical Behavioural Therapy (DBT).
